2. The “Mystic Polar Express” has arrived in the Children’s Room at the Mystic & Noank Library. Barry Boodman and Bill Salancy created and donated what has become a holiday tradition. Children and families are invited to visit the library during regular hours to make the train puff and toot its way around this magical, mystical setting. As a fundraiser, the library is auctioning off the entire set throughout the month of December. Bidding closes on Saturday, December 22 at 2 p.m. The Mystic & Noank Library is located at 40 Library St., Mystic, Conn. Call 860-536-7721 or email mnl@juno.com for more information.
